%STARTINCLUDE%
body {
font-family: Liberation Sans, Arial, helvetica, sans-serif;
font-size: 14px;
background: #6E6E6E;
margin: 0px;
padding: 0px;
}
#wraper {
background: #FFF;
text-align: center;
}
#header {
width: 800px;
margin: auto;
position: relative;
}
#logo {
margin: 0px;
padding: 0px;
}
#logo a {
float: right;
display: block;
width: 305px;
height: 95px;
background: url(%ATTACHURL%/logo-colivre-horiz.ind.png) 50% 50% no-repeat;
}
#logo span {
display: none;
}
#banner {
position: absolute;
top: 32px;
left: -40px;
}
/*******************************************************************/
#folow-us {
position: absolute;
top: 30px;
left: 25px;
}
#folow-us a {
float: left;
display: block;
position: relative;
}
#folow-us span {
display: none;
}
#twitter {
background-image: url(%ATTACHURL%/follow-us-twitter.png?v=2);
width: 113px;
height: 54px;
top: 8px;
}
#identica {
background-image: url(%ATTACHURL%/follow-us-identica.png?v=2);
width: 103px;
height: 82px;
top: -12px;
left: 20px;
}
/*******************************************************************/
#menu-borda {
background: #555 url(%ATTACHURL%/menu-bg.png);
height: 30px;
clear: right;
text-align: center;
}
#menu {
width: 800px;
margin: 0px auto;
}
#menu ul {
float: right;
margin: 0px;
padding: 6px 0px 0px 0px;
position: relative;
right: -10px;
}
#menu li {
margin: 0px;
padding: 0px;
display: inline;
}
#menu a {
display: block;
float: left;
font-size: 14px;
line-height: 20px;
margin-left: 20px;
text-decoration: none;
color: #DDD;
font-weight: bold;
}
.msie6 #menu a {
position: relative;
top: 1px;
}
#menu a span {
padding: 5px 10px;
}
#menu a:hover {
color: #FFF;
}
.parent-Institucional #item-inst a, .topic-Institucional #item-inst a,
.parent-Solucoes #item-solu a, .topic-Solucoes #item-solu a,
.parent-Capacitacao #item-capa a, .topic-Capacitacao #item-capa a,
.parent-Clientes #item-clie a, .topic-Clientes #item-clie a,
.parent-Contato #item-cont a, .topic-Contato #item-cont a {
font-weight: bold;
background: #C00 url(%ATTACHURL%/menu-ativo-dir.png);
color: #FFF;
line-height: 25px;
}
.parent-Institucional #item-inst a span, .topic-Institucional #item-inst a span,
.parent-Solucoes #item-solu a span, .topic-Solucoes #item-solu a span,
.parent-Capacitacao #item-capa a span, .topic-Capacitacao #item-capa a span,
.parent-Clientes #item-clie a span, .topic-Clientes #item-clie a span,
.parent-Contato #item-cont a span, .topic-Contato #item-cont a span {
background: url(%ATTACHURL%/menu-ativo-esq.png) 100% 0% no-repeat;
}
/*******************************************************************/
#interno {
text-align: left;
padding-top: 1px;
padding-bottom: 30px;
width: 800px;
margin: auto;
position: relative;
}
.msie6 #interno {
left: 40px;
}
#cont-tit-header {
background: #C01010 url(%ATTACHURL%/title-bg.png) 0% 100%;
width: 880px;
max-width: 800px;
margin: 0px;
padding: 5px 40px;
color: #FFF;
text-align: right;
font-size: 26px;
position: relative;
left: -40px;
}
#cont-tit-header span {
display: inline-table;
width: 100%;
text-align: left;
padding-left: 140px;
}
/*******************************************************************/
#extra {
float: left;
position: relative;
top: -34px;
left: -25px;
}
#sub-menu-borda {
background: #F9F9F9 url(%ATTACHURL%/sub-menu-meio.png);
width: 132px;
}
#sub-menu {
background: url(%ATTACHURL%/sub-menu-base.png) 0% 100% no-repeat;
}
#sub-menu ul {
margin: 0px;
padding: 8px 11px;
background: url(%ATTACHURL%/sub-menu-top.png) no-repeat;
}
#sub-menu li {
margin: 0px;
padding: 8px 5px;
width: 110px;
max-width: 100px;
border-top: 1px solid #DDD;
text-align: right;
font-weight: bold;
list-style: none;
}
#sub-menu li.first {
border: none;
}
#sub-menu a {
text-decoration: none;
color: #C00;
}
#sub-menu a:hover {
color: #000;
}
/* #sub-menu .palavra-grande {
letter-spacing: -1px;
} */
/*******************************************************************/
#noticias {
text-align: right;
width: 128px;
padding-top: 20px;
}
#noticias h3 {
color: #CCC;
margin: 0px;
padding: 5px 0px;
font-size: 16px;
}
#noticias ul {
margin: 0px;
padding: 0px;
}
#noticias li {
margin: 0px;
padding: 5px 0px;
list-style: none;
}
#noticias a {
font-size: 12px;
text-decoration: none;
color: #B00;
}
#noticias a:hover {
color: #000;
}
#noticias .twikiAlert {
display: none;
}
.user-is-admin #noticias .twikiAlert {
display: block;
color: red;
}
/*******************************************************************/
#conteudo {
float: right;
text-align: justify;
width: 660px;
padding-top: 20px;
}
.msie #conteudo {
padding-top: 30px;
}
#cont-tit {
display: none;
}
#conteudo h1, #conteudo h2, #conteudo h3,
#conteudo h4, #conteudo h5, #conteudo h6 {
color: #B00;
}
#conteudo h1 { font-size: 24px }
#conteudo h2 { font-size: 20px }
#conteudo h3 { font-size: 18px }
#conteudo h4 { font-size: 16px }
#conteudo h5 { font-size: 15px }
#conteudo h6 { font-size: 14px }
.float-left {
float: left;
margin: 0px 20px 5px 0px;
}
.float-right {
float: right;
margin: 0px 0px 5px 20px;
}
#conteudo a {
color: #B00;
}
#conteudo a:visited {
color: #B66;
}
#conteudo a:hover {
color: #F00;
}
#conteudo ul li {
padding: 2px 0px;
list-style-image: url(%ATTACHURL%/list-glip.gif);
}
#conteudo .twikiToc li {
list-style-image: url(%ATTACHURL%/toc-glip.gif);
}
#conteudo .twikiToc a {
text-decoration: none;
}
#conteudo .twikiToc a:hover {
text-decoration: underline;
}
/*******************************************************************/
#rodape {
background: #6E6E6E url(%ATTACHURL%/rodape-bg.png) repeat-x;
color: #AAA;
font-size: 11px;
line-height: 17px;
letter-spacing: 1px;
text-align: center;
}
#rodape-inner {
padding-top: 15px;
width: 880px;
margin: auto;
text-align: right;
}
.loaded #rodape-inner {
/* A classe "loaded" é adicionada ao body no evento onload,
* assim podemos deixar para adicionar certos elementos (açúcar)
* apenas após todo o layout e conteúdo estarem carregados.
*/
background: url(%ATTACHURL%/colivre-gear-ani2.gif) 50% -20px no-repeat;
}
#rodape #rodape-inner a {
color: #AAA;
text-decoration: none;
}
#rodape #rodape-inner a:hover {
color: #EEE;
}
#rodape p {
margin: 0px;
padding: 10px 0px;
}
#sobre {
float: left;
text-align: left;
padding-left: 10px;
position: relative;
left: -30px;
}
/*******************************************************************/
#flags {
float: left;
margin-left: -45px;
padding-top: 7px;
font-size: 11px;
}
#flags a {
float: left;
margin-left: 10px;
text-decoration: none;
color: #999;
display: block;
width: 19px;
height: 13px;
opacity: 0.3;
-ms-filter:"progid:DXImageTransform.Microsoft.Alpha(Opacity=30)"; /* MSIE 8 (sux a lot) */
filter: alpha(opacity=30); /* MSIE old (sux) */
}
#flags a:hover {
opacity: 1;
-ms-filter:"progid:DXImageTransform.Microsoft.Alpha(Opacity=100)"; /* MSIE 8 (sux a lot) */
filter: alpha(opacity=100); /* MSIE old (sux) */
}
#flags span {
display: none;
position: relative;
top: 13px;
left: -15px;
}
#flags a:hover span {
display: block;
}
#flag-pt {
background: url(%ATTACHURL%/flag-br-nocolor.png);
}
#flag-en {
background: url(%ATTACHURL%/flag-en-nocolor.png);
}
/*******************************************************************/
#busca {
float: left;
margin: 0px;
padding: 5px 0px 0px 20px;
position: relative;
z-index: 10;
}
#busca input {
text-align: center;
border: 1px solid #DDD;
color: #999;
background: #FFF;
-moz-border-radius: 4px;
-webkit-border-radius: 4px;
border-radius: 4px;
width: 131px;
}
.msie #busca input {
position: relative;
top: 10px;
}
#busca.clean input {
color: #BBB;
}
#busca.focused input {
border: 1px solid #999;
color: #444;
}
#busca div {
visibility: hidden;
font-size: 11px;
}
#busca.focused div {
visibility: visible;
padding: 0px 5px;
-moz-border-radius: 5px;
border-radius: 5px;
color: #555;
background: #FFF;
opacity: 0.75;
filter: alpha(opacity = 75);
}
/*******************************************************************/
#wiki-bts {
position: fixed;
left: 2%;
top: 150px;
text-align: left;
}
#wiki-bts a {
display: block;
text-decoration: none;
color: #DDD;
padding: 1px 5px 1px 8px;
/* border: 1px solid transparent; */
-moz-border-radius: 5px;
}
#wiki-bts a:hover {
color: #FFF;
background: #C00;
/* border: 1px solid #A00; */
}
/************************ Opera ***************************/
.opera #menu a span {
padding-top: 4px;
}
/************************ Chrome ***************************/
.webkit #menu a span {
padding-top: 4px;
}
%STOPINCLUDE%
O código CSS deste site.
Software Livre
Missão, Visão e Valores
Contribuição para a Comunidade
Blog |
Identi.ca |
Twitter
Créditos ♥
Rua Marechal Floriano, nº 28,
ed. Norma Camozzato, sala 301
Canela - Salvador - Bahia - Brasil
CEP: 40110-010
Telefones: +55-71-3331-2299
+55-71-3011-2199